About This Program

The Surgical Technology/Technologist program at Connecticut State Community College is a two- to four-year certificate program at this public institution in Hartford, CT. The program prepares students to assist surgical teams in operating rooms by covering sterile technique, surgical procedures, instrumentation, and patient safety protocols.

This certificate is part of the surgical technology field (CIP 51.0909) and is among the health and technical programs offered at Connecticut State Community College. Students can expect a combination of classroom instruction and clinical training covering surgical specialties, aseptic practices, and the roles and responsibilities of surgical technologists in perioperative care settings.
